What are the side effects of generic Cilostazol, and how do they compare to alternatives?
Common side effects include headache, diarrhea, and palpitations. Compared to aspirin or clopidogrel, cilostazol is more specialized for claudication but may cause tachycardia in some patients. Pentoxifylline, while cheaper, is less effective for walking distance improvement. Always report adverse effects to your physician.

Is Cilostazol right for me?
Cilostazol is specifically prescribed for symptoms of peripheral artery disease (PAD), such as leg pain during walking (intermittent claudication). It is not recommended for individuals with heart failure (due to risk of worsening symptoms) or severe liver impairment. If you have arrhythmias or a history of bleeding disorders, alternatives like aspirin or pentoxifylline may be safer. For diabetic patients with PAD, cilostazol can improve blood flow but requires monitoring for interactions with other medications. Always undergo a cardiovascular evaluation before starting treatment to ensure it aligns with your medical history and current therapies.
